Deon Thompson atones for recent lapses


Given his struggles during the ACC Tournament, said the UNC coaching staff didn't have to send so much as the tiniest challenge in his vicinity. "I knew how bad I was," the sophomore forward said Friday night at the RBC Center. That's why his role in the top-ranked Tar Heels' 113-74 demolition of Mount St. Mary's emerged as one of the more important rays of sunshine in an altogether radiant performance.
